SIDE EFFECTS As with many medications, it is difficult to sort out the side effects from the desired effects since there are many uses for this drug. Diazepam is rarely used as a tranquilizer for animals as it simply not very strong and not very reliable; still, undesired sedating effects are certainly reported when this medication is used. Diazepam is sometimes used as an appetite stimulant but its sedating properties preclude it from being the drug of choice for this purpose. In the cat, cases of liver failure have been reported after several days use of diazepam. Since this medication has many valid uses in cats, it is important to check a cat's liver enzymes prior to the institution of therapy and again a few days after starting therapy. INTERACTIONS WITH OTHER DRUGS Diazepam may have a stronger than expected effect if used in conjunction with Cimetidine (an antacid more commonly known as Tagamet), erythromycin (an antibiotic), ketoconazole (an antifungal drug), or propranolol (a heart medication). Antacids may slow the onset of effect of diazepam. The use of diazepam may increase the effect of digoxin (a heart medication). Diazepam should not be used in conjunction with amitraz (Mitaban) dips for mange, nor in conjunction with ivermectintreatments for parasites. CONCERNS AND CAUTIONS This medication should be stored at room temperature and protected from light. Urine dipsticks that measure glucose may be falsely negative in patients taking diazepam. Discontinuing diazepam therapy abruptly may lead to unpleasant withdrawal symptoms similar to those that occur in humans. Common manifestations of stress in cats: Inappropriate elimination (litterbox problems) Territorial marking behaviors, including spraying Excessive grooming and self-mutilation Immobility (depression) and hiding Redirected aggression (toward people or other pets) Excessive vocalization Loss of appetite Restlessness All of these behaviors can also be symptoms of illness, so it is important to take the cat to the veterinarian as soon as possible to rule out health problems as being the cause for the aberrant behavior. Stress-related Housesoiling Problems One of the most common feline responses to stress is inappropriate elimination. The bladder is the cat's stress target. If the source of stress is the litter or the litterbox itself (too dirty, too perfumed, too confining) then the stool or urine is often deposited right next to the litterbox. If the cat is experiencing territorial anxiety over the sight of cats, dogs, or wildlife outside, then the cat may spray windows, doors, drapes or prominent objects in the room where the windows are located. Blocking the cat's view of the outside may help to eliminate these marking problems. It may be that the cat is stressed by another cat in the household. Perhaps he is ambushed on his way to the litterbox or he is afraid to pass through the other cat's territory to get to his litterbox.
